Rho Downtown Apartment Rhodes City is located a 19-minute walk from St Athanasios' Gate and around 5 minutes' drive from Archaeological Museum of Rhodes.
The 1-room Rho Downtown Apartment has a dressing room, and comforts such as an air conditioner. This property is equipped with a bathroom that features towels and slippers. A walk-in shower and a separate toilet can also be found.
The apartment comes with a refrigerator and a stovetop available in a fully equipped kitchen. The dessert restaurant Pure - Sweets & More is situated right by this accommodation. Diagoras of Rhodes bus stop can be found a minute's walk from the 40 m² apartment.
Old Town can be reached by car in a few minutes, while Santa Maria Della Vittoria Catholic Church is right by Rho Downtown Apartment. The city centre is just 2 km away and Diagoras airport is 15 km from this apartment.